Output df21ad26a88283a2770402aef20188312fe4f7b828029008dd4ded9cbbb45c91:47

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5a11e268df71ad042421adb4d5d564b80cef0c243bc46aa0d4f66ba66dc0c7f7
address
bc1ptgg7y6xlwxksgfpp4k6dt4tyhqxw7rpy80zx4gx57e46vmwqclmsc3kxfq
transaction
df21ad26a88283a2770402aef20188312fe4f7b828029008dd4ded9cbbb45c91
spent
true